Key thresholds in technical analysis
Crypto analyst CasiTrades noted that XRP recently touched the 0.786 Fibonacci retracement level at $1.09. In technical analysis, this area is frequently seen as a last strong line of defense where reversals may begin to form. The rebound from this region, which pushed the price back above $1.12, has increased expectations that a short-term local bottom may have been set.
According to the analyst, the $1.12 level is currently the market’s closest battleground. This area also overlaps with the 0.5 Fibonacci retracement mark. If buyers are able to defend this support in the short run, the recovery could gain traction, with $1.25 emerging as the next key resistance zone.
CasiTrades emphasized that maintaining support at $1.12 could fuel a recovery, but the $1.25 territory is likely to be decisive for XRP’s next major direction.
Why is the $1.25 zone under scrutiny?
According to Elliott Wave analysis, the $1.25 level marks the upper boundary of a potential fourth wave recovery. A firm break through this barrier would likely be seen as a significant signal of renewed bullish momentum. In this scenario, confidence could rise that a broader correction in XRP may have already bottomed out.
On the other hand, failure to decisively surpass $1.25 could suggest that the current upward move is merely a temporary reaction within a larger corrective trend. For the bullish outlook to strengthen, XRP must first stay above $1.12, then reclaim $1.25 convincingly. A move above $1.30 could reinforce the recovery, while any surge toward $1.65 would greatly decrease the risk of another sharp decline.
Mini glossary: Elliott Wave theory suggests that market moves unfold in recurring waves shaped by investor psychology. Fibonacci retracement is used to determine key support or resistance levels after significant price moves.
What are the critical levels if the outlook turns negative?
If sellers regain strength in the resistance area, a renewed downturn remains a possibility. According to CasiTrades, a reversal near $1.25 could drive XRP back to test support at $1.09. Should this level also fail, the price could potentially fall as low as $0.90.
Such a move might represent the conclusion of a much larger second wave correction. The analyst believes that following a correction of this magnitude, the foundation for a more sustainable recovery could be established. Thus, how the price behaves between $1.12 and $1.25 in the short term is now being closely watched, as it may reveal whether XRP’s recent bounce is signaling a lasting bottom or just a fleeting rally.
